Richardson earns prestigious award through Marine Corps

LHS grad Jennifer Richardson was honored with a prestigious Marine Corps award.
Ssgt. Jennifer K. Richardson, a Lampasas High School graduate, received the PFC Herbert A. Littleton Award which recognizes individuals for significant contributions and accomplishments in the field of command, control, communications and computers in support of the Marine Corps Operational Communications Mission.

Ms. Richardson was invited to Washington, D.C., to accept the prestigious award.

Ms. Richardson, who entered the Marine Corps in 1998, is serving with the 9th Communications Battalion at Camp Pendleton, Calif., and soon will deploy for her second tour to the Al Anbar Province of Iraq.

Following her desert tour, Ms. Richardson will go to South Carolina where she will serve as a drill instructor.

She previously was stationed in Kuwait, Saudi Arabia and Okinawa.

She is the daughter of Bonnie Richardson Pabst and the granddaughter of Doris Richardson and the late Joe Richardson, all of Lampasas.
